This position has the following specific responsibilities:
-Understand and maintain water treatment regulations and requirements
-Analyze tanks and cleaners daily
-At least three times per week, make acid additions to plating lines
-Maintain organized documentation of testing results
-Work with office staff to purchase chemicals, metals, etc. as necessary
-Notify supervisor of any abnormal or unusual conditions
-Perform other duties as necessary
Physical Requirements and Work Environment
Employee is required to bend, climb and twist. Usage of hands to grasp and manipulate objects, tools or controls is required. This position requires squatting, pushing, pulling, walking, standing and sitting. The ability to lift/push/pull up to 50 pounds is necessary.
The ambient conditions of the waste water treatment area and plating lines are moderate and noise levels are moderate. Working in this environment includes dust, fumes, cold, heat and humidity from the chemical solutions. Required to wear appropriate PPE when in waste water treatment and in plating area.
Minimum Qualifications
This position must have a high school diploma or one year experience in a water treatment facility, preferably in the plating system. This position requires strong organizational skills and a background in math and chemistry.
